Skip to content

Instantly share code, notes, and snippets.

View khilkevichigor's full-sized avatar
💭
show must go on. Java

Khilkevich Igor khilkevichigor

💭
show must go on. Java
View GitHub Profile
@khilkevichigor
khilkevichigor / add_react_app.md
Last active January 16, 2021 22:18
Добавляем в существующий проект проект на React

Добавляем фронт на React в существующий проект

Генерим фронт с React, - для этого в терминале idea выполняем команду

npx create-react-app front,

где front - это название директории с фронтендом на React

P.S. перед созданием фронтенда сам проект уже должен быть запушен на github.com иначе в директории front будет подмодуль гита от которого потом сложно будет изюбавиться (на гитхабе папка front тупо не откроется)!

@khilkevichigor
khilkevichigor / procfile.md
Last active January 10, 2021 19:17
Procfile в корне для heroku

Procfile в корне проекта для деплоя на heroku.com

В корне проекта создаем файл Procfile (без расширения!).

Для приложения SpringBoot2 + React содержимое такое:

web java -Dserver.port=$PORT $JAVA_OPTS -jar target/shmot-0.0.1-SNAPSHOT.war,

где shmot-0.0.1-SNAPSHOT.war - имя Вашего jar-ника.

@khilkevichigor
khilkevichigor / add_dyno_from_heroku.md
Last active January 13, 2021 18:46
Добавления dyno в heroku для работы веб-приложения

Heroku CLI (интерфейс командной строки)

Интерфейс командной строки Heroku (CLI) упрощает создание приложений Heroku и управление ими прямо из терминала. Это важная часть использования Heroku.

Начало работы

  1. Установить Heroku (CLI)
  2. Залогиниться - в терминале idea выполнить команду heroku login

Добавление heroku dyno для работы веб-приложения на heroku.com

@khilkevichigor
khilkevichigor / run_app_from_jar.md
Last active January 16, 2021 22:20
Запуск приложения с jar файла

Запуск приложения локально с jar-файла

После сборки приложения maven-ом clean + install - в терминале (mvn clean install) idea выполняем команду mvn --projects backend spring-boot:run или еще так java -jar target/shmot-0.0.1-SNAPSHOT.war, где shmot-0.0.1-SNAPSHOT.war - имя Вашего jar-ника

@khilkevichigor
khilkevichigor / run_spring_boot_from_terminal.md
Last active January 10, 2021 19:20
Запуск приложения SpringBoot из терминала

Запуск приложения SpringBoot локально из терминала

Для старта приложения - в терминале idea выполняем команду:

mvn spring-boot:run

Для остановки приложения - в терминале idea нажимаем

Ctrl + C